OVERVIEW:
This small mod does exactly one thing: it adds carryweight bonuses to all the companion perks. What it adds is kept uniform: 100lbs for humans, 50 for creatures, and 150 for Super Mutants/Star Paladin Cross (due to her power armor). This idea is inspired by Obsidian's The Outer Worlds where companions simply buff your carry capacity instead of having a discrete inventory. There already exists a more elegant implementation of this on the Nexus in the form of Convenient Companion Inventory, and it's a great mod, but unfortunately it has a few bugs which prevent it from being the perfect solution and it's not been updated in 4 years. And so in order to achieve the same thing in a more "fool-proof" way, I opted for a stupid simple approach. However, the simplicity of it means that there are some limitations:

-It only works on vanilla companions
-It's completely static and not dynamic at all, so buffing your companions strength won't give you more weight
-Your companion's own carry weight remains the same so you can easily cheese it by using the buff AND their inventory (I contemplated debuffing their carryweight but decided against it. I'm not your dad, if you want to exploit it or don't, that's on you. This mod exists for convenience above all else, NOT balance)

COMPATIBILITY:
This mod solely edits companion perks and nothing else, so it should be highly compatible. Versions made for use alongside Sweet Perk Overhaul are provided. Any other mods that edit the same perks will conflict, but patching it is simple and I might do so by request.
